Transaction 5c184ab6a08333ebe88bf2be705fc76b6f30fd75fae662e57ca435962ee63bbe

1 Input
2 Outputs
  • 5c184ab6a08333ebe88bf2be705fc76b6f30fd75fae662e57ca435962ee63bbe:0
  • value  35688539
    address  1E4zYAtdfpKTqrKpedZMDbxsX8dwivCxP6
  • 5c184ab6a08333ebe88bf2be705fc76b6f30fd75fae662e57ca435962ee63bbe:1
  • value  164305811
    address  13EDzzRwgFCrkKjcSeBZxQDYdEMkoQHUVR